Inheritance Tax and Exempt Transfers
For inheritance tax (IHT) purposes, gifts fall into one of three categories: exempt transfers, potentially exempt transfers (PETs), and chargeable lifetime transfers (CLTs). In this article, we focus on the first category – exempt transfers.
